Cultural and Linguistic Influences
Most dark elf names borrow from fantasy language roots inspired by Old English, archaic elvish dialects (as seen in Tolkien-inspired constructs), and dark mythos. They often incorporate elements like:
- Dark consonants: “K,” “Z,” “X,” “V” for tough, imposing sounds
- Nature and shadow motifs: References to night, twilight, ravens, or twilight forests
- Mystical suffixes or prefixes: “-Nir,” “-Vel,” “Shadow-,” “Ember-”

Tips for Crafting Your Own Dark Elf Name
- Play with phonetics: Use harsh “k” or “z” sounds for menace; soft “l” or “m” for wisdom and mystery.
- Incorporate symbolic elements: Fire, night, iron, shadow, or ravens add depth.
- Adopt a naming tradition: Dark elf cultures often pass names through lineage, adopt lost names, or use meaningful epithets.
- Mix fantasy languages: Inspire with Tolkien’s Quenya/Dorith or create your own syllables and roots.
